+#include "libioP.h"
+#include <string.h>
+#include <wchar.h>
+
+#if defined _LIBC || !_G_HAVE_IO_GETLINE_INFO
+
+_IO_size_t
+_IO_getwline (fp, buf, n, delim, extract_delim)
+ _IO_FILE *fp;
+ wchar_t *buf;
+ _IO_size_t n;
+ wint_t delim;
+ int extract_delim;
+{
+ return _IO_getwline_info (fp, buf, n, delim, extract_delim, (wint_t *) 0);
+}
+
+/* Algorithm based on that used by Berkeley pre-4.4 fgets implementation.
+
+ Read chars into buf (of size n), until delim is seen.
+ Return number of chars read (at most n).
+ Does not put a terminating '\0' in buf.
+ If extract_delim < 0, leave delimiter unread.
+ If extract_delim > 0, insert delim in output. */
+
+_IO_size_t
+_IO_getwline_info (fp, buf, n, delim, extract_delim, eof)
+ _IO_FILE *fp;
+ wchar_t *buf;
+ _IO_size_t n;
+ wint_t delim;
+ int extract_delim;
+ wint_t *eof;
+{
+ wchar_t *ptr = buf;
+ if (eof != NULL)
+ *eof = 0;
+ while (n != 0)
+ {
+ _IO_ssize_t len = (f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_end
+ - f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_ptr);
+ if (len <= 0)
+ {
+ wint_t wc = __wuflow (fp);
+ if (wc == WEOF)
+ {
+ if (eof)
+ *eof = wc;
+ break;
+ }
+ if (wc == delim)
+ {
+ if (extract_delim > 0)
+ *ptr++ = wc;
+ else if (extract_delim < 0)
+ _IO_sputbackc (fp, wc);
+ return ptr - buf;
+ if (extract_delim > 0)
+ ++len;
+ }
+ *ptr++ = wc;
+ n--;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 wchar_t *t;
+ if ((_IO_size_t) len >= n)
+ len = n;
+ t = (wchar_t *) memchr ((void *) f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_ptr,
+ delim, len);
+ if (t != NULL)
+ {
+ _IO_size_t old_len = ptr - buf;
+ len = t - f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_ptr;
+ if (extract_delim >= 0)
+ {
+ ++t;
+ if (extract_delim > 0)
+ ++len;
+ }
+ memcpy ((void *) ptr, (void *) f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_ptr,
+ len);
+ f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_ptr = t;
+ return old_len + len;
+ }
+ memcpy ((void *) ptr, (void *) f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_ptr, len);
+ fp->_wide_data->_IO_read_ptr += len;
+ ptr += len;
+ n -= len;
+ }
+ }
+ return ptr - buf;
+}
+
+#endif /* Defined _LIBC || !_G_HAVE_IO_GETLINE_INFO */
